Ukraine, Azerbaijan mull resumption of flights

Ukrainian Ministry of Foreign Affairs is holding talks with the relevant bodies of Azerbaijan, Georgia, Turkey, and Bulgaria on the resumption of flights, said Deputy Minister Yevheniy Yenin, Report informs, citing foreign media.
According to him, there are already positive signals.
“Ukraine will firstly resume flights to countries, in which the epidemiological situation is under control. Our citizens traveling from Ukraine to those countries will have to test negative for coronavirus,” he said.
